Deutsche Börse Group is one of the world’s leading exchange organisations and an innovative market infrastructure provider. With our products and services, we ensure that capital markets are fair, transparent, reliable, and stable. Together, we develop state-of-the-art IT solutions and offer our IT systems all over the world. 

Within the Deutsche Börse Group, Clearstream is an international central securities depository (ICSD). It provides post-trade infrastructure and securities services for the international market and 59 domestic markets worldwide, with customers in 110 countries.

Your area of work:

As a Senior Project Manager within Custody & Investor Solutions, you will lead and coordinate strategic transformation initiatives across the Asset Servicing and Settlement landscape. Acting as a bridge between business, operations, technology, clients, and market infrastructures, you will drive the successful delivery of regulatory, market, and digital change programmes. A key focus of the role is shaping and advancing Clearstream's Digital CSD agenda, ensuring that emerging technologies such as Distributed Ledger Technology (DLT), tokenization, and digital assets are effectively integrated into the future post-trade ecosystem while maintaining alignment with existing custody and settlement services.

 

Your responsibilities:

  • Lead strategic transformation programmes and cross-functional projects across Asset Servicing, Settlement, and Digital CSD initiatives.
  • Drive the implementation of market infrastructure changes, migrations, regulatory programmes, and new service offerings.
  • Act as the business lead for Digital CSD initiatives within Custody & Investor Solutions, ensuring alignment with Clearstream's digital asset strategy.
  • Manage project governance, stakeholder engagement, risk mitigation, and executive reporting across complex initiatives.
  • Provide subject matter expertise in custody, settlement, and asset servicing processes, ensuring business requirements are reflected in solution design.
  • Coordinate internal teams, external vendors, clients, market infrastructures, regulators, and industry bodies thro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Lead the development and implementation of Digital CSD use cases, pilot programmes, and scalable business solutions.
  • Monitor market, regulatory, and technology developments to identify opportunities for innovation and business growth.

 

Your profile:

  • Master's degree or equivalent university qualification in Finance, Economics, Business Administration, Information Technology, or a related discipline.
  • Minimum 8 years of professional experience in post-trade, custody, asset servicing, settlement, or financial market infrastructure environments.
  • Proven track record in leading complex cross-functional projects, transformation programmes, or strategic change initiatives.
  • Strong expertise in Asset Servicing and Settlement processes across multiple asset classes and international markets.
  • Good understanding of DLT, tokenization, digital assets, smart contracts, and related market developments.
  • Excellent analytical, stakeholder management, communication, and presentation skills, with the ability to engage at all organizational levels.
  • Self-driven, collaborative, and adaptable, with the ability to manage multiple priorities in a dynamic environment.
  • Fluency in English is required; knowledge of French and/or German is considered a strong advantage.
